Why Suction Bot Is Trending Right Now
Suction Bot is technically trending because it literally launched 1 day ago — but don't expect a player spike. It hit 0 peak concurrent players in its first 24 hours, with 0% positive reviews (no reviews submitted yet). This is a cold launch with zero community momentum.
The game's hook is solid: a mouse-only platformer where you climb from a sewer to space, dodging swinging pendulums, flying pigeons, and wrecking balls. It's a niche concept targeting puzzle-platformer fans who want precision mouse controls, not gamepad junkies.

Common Questions About Suction Bot
Is Suction Bot worth buying in 2026?
Not yet — there's literally zero community data to evaluate. No reviews, no player retention signal. If mouse-precision platformers are your thing, it's worth a shot on launch discount, but don't expect a polished, well-tuned experience. Wait for reviews from actual players.
How many players does Suction Bot have?
0 players in the first 24 hours. 0% trend movement. This is a hard launch with no initial traction. The game needs YouTube buzz or streamer adoption to break out.
Is Suction Bot multiplayer or co-op?
Suction Bot is singleplayer only. No multiplayer, co-op, or PvP mentioned. It's a solo climbing experience.
